SimplegTool ==================== .. py:class:: GeoEDF.processor.SimplegTool() Module for running 02_data_proc binary file that generates two database files ( LANDDATA.har, DATACHKS.har). SimplegTool requires two parameters: 1) har_input_dir : directory where INC, POP, QCROP, VCROP, QLAND data exist 2) target_year : base year An economic model (02_data_proc.tab) is compiled into a Fortran code by GEMPACK program(copsmodels.com), and then transforms into an executable named 02_data_proc. The resulting executable/binary takes a command file (CMF) that instructs model to load inputs(INC, POP, QCROP, and so on). User needs to edit the cmf file in order to select the base year(which is same as target_year,one of the required parameters). User specified target_year will be automatically set in the command file through edit_CMF_target_path(). Remember that base year or target_year must fall within start_year and end_year of the SimpleDataClean processor.
